Role of Silanol Group in Sn-Beta Zeolite for Glucose Isomerization and Epimerization Reactions [PDF]
Density functional calculations are used to elucidate the role of the silanol group adjacent to the active site Sn metal center of the Sn-BEA zeolite in the isomerization and epimerization of glucose.

An Unexpected Rearrangement during Mitsunobu Epimerization Reaction of Sugar Derivatives [PDF]
Mitsunobu reaction on the glucose derivative (3S,4R,5R,6R)-3,4,5,7-tetrabenzyloxy-6-hydroxy-1-heptene yielded an unexpected rearrangement major product. Its structure was determined as (3R,4R,5R,6S)-4,5,6,7-tetrabenzyloxy-3-hydroxy-1-heptene.
